Как предотвратить увеличение ввода текста в IOS? Я знаю, что это было задано раньше, и обычная мудрость заключалась в том, чтобы на вкладке был шрифт не менее 16 пикселей.
Однако, похоже, это не работает с современными ios-устройствами (последние iphones), хотя, похоже, работает на более старом ipad.
Любые текущие решения? Я предпочитаю искать css или чисто javascript-решение.
Я знаю, что мы могли бы полностью отключить масштабирование для страницы, но это не является желательным решением.
Вы пытались указать все входы, а также добавили свойство focus следующим образом:
@media #{$small-and-down} {
// styles for small screens and down
input[type="color"],
input[type="date"],
input[type="datetime"],
input[type="datetime-local"],
input[type="email"],
input[type="month"],
input[type="number"],
input[type="password"],
input[type="search"],
input[type="tel"],
input[type="text"],
input[type="time"],
input[type="url"],
input[type="week"],
select:focus,
textarea {
font-size: 16px !important;
}
@media screen and (-webkit-min-device-pixel-ratio:0) {
select:focus,
textarea:focus,
input:focus {
font-size: 16px !important;
}
}